Dark, glowing fruit pours from the glass in the 2018 Livio Sassetti Brunello di Montalcino Pertimali, with black cherry, plum and a touch of cola lifted by wild herbs, cocoa and floral spice. The palate is lush yet firmly structured, packed with ripe red and black fruit and underpinned by vibrant acidity and gripping, polished tannins that clearly mark this as a Brunello built for the cellar rather than quick pleasure. Give it time and it promises to evolve from dense and intense into something far more complex and silken.

Brunello di Montalcino Pertimali by Livio Sassetti is a benchmark, single‑estate Brunello from the Montosoli hill in northern Montalcino, crafted from 100% Sangiovese Grosso grown on marl- and clay-based soils at about 300 meters elevation. Traditionally vinified and aged long-term in large Slavonian oak botti, it is known for uniting Montosoli’s elegant, perfumed character with depth and structure, yielding Brunellos that are both powerfully built and refined, with notable ageing potential.
